Team Mopar driver Brian Collins followed up his back-to-back wins at the SCORE San Felipe 250 and SNORE Mint 400 with a podium finish on May 31 at the 40th Tecate SCORE Baja 500.
Collins was also bidding for a three-peat at the Baja 500, which he won in 2006 and 2007, but came up just short in his attempt. The Las Vegas resident slid into a tree and suffered a flat tire on the No. 12 Collins Motorsports Mopar Dodge Ram 1500, then lost precious minutes when the truck sank into talcum powder-like sand as the flat was fixed. The stroke of misfortune relegated Collins and co-driver Chuck Hovey to a still strong third-place finish overall in the SCORE Trophy Truck class of the SCORE Desert Series. Collins and Hovey navigated the grueling desert course in 9:25:47 at 46.78 mph.
“The No. 12 Mopar Dodge Ram 1500 ran flawless,” said Collins. “Everyone said it looked fast. It performed beautifully.”
